♡ Makes you more efficient

Having a daily routine is one of the most important things you can do to increase your efficiency. When you have a daily routine, you’ll spend less time wondering what you’re supposed to be doing, and more time actually doing.

♡ Breaks bad habits/builds good habits

The best way to kick a bad habit is to replace it with a good one. That’s a fact. But we get it…it’s so much easier said than done. So, here’s where a good daily routine comes in to save the day. When you set time aside in your day for all your positive and healthy habits, you reduce the time available for your poor habits. And you might even forget about them altogether.

♡ Improves mental health

Having a daily routine can do wonders for your mental health. Seriously. It helps you feel like you have more control over your life and that you’re in the driver’s seat of your own destiny. An organized daily routine also reduces stress by taking away the paradox of choice. Instead of stressing over all the things you could do, you have a set plan that will help you accomplish your goals.

♡ Schedule breaks

The best way to stick to a daily routine is to set aside time for it. But something that many people don’t realize is this: scheduling breaks can actually help you stick to your daily routine, too.

Decide on a specific number of minutes each day that you’ll devote to each activity, then block or “batch” off that time in your calendar. Being sure to leave time for your built-in walking, coffee, and lunch breaks. Then, if you find yourself getting distracted and veering away from the task at hand, take a break and go back to it later. More on time batching as a productivity hack here
